This Year 8 Italian unit of work is designed to engage students through innovative use of technology, strategic use of High Impact Teaching Strategies and meaningful opportunities to learn and use Italian language. It is based on the Victorian Curriculum: Italian (7-12 pathway) and includes the unit planner and all teacher and student resources required for the 12 lesson sequence (15 resources in total).

In this unit, students work together to plan a celebration, discussing possible dates and times, as well as needs and preferences relating to food and drink, quantities required and making plans with friends. The unit culminates in a celebration of learning with a class ‘party’ which will allow students to share work created throughout the unit.

Ideas for using this resource

- While the unit is presented as a 12-lesson sequence, the total number of lessons/weeks could be adjusted based on varying lesson lengths at different schools. There is flexibility for certain learning intentions/activities to be emphasised or extended, to respond to students’ needs for reinforcement of particular content or to explore areas of interest more deeply. Similarly, there is scope for students in need of extension to adopt an inquiry-based approach, allowing them to move beyond the key language presented in the unit. 

- The unit planner is comprehensive and provides the HITS alongside the learning activities. It would also be a useful starting unit for Year 8 and a textbook alternative (as a way of organising your own units and moving away from coursebooks).

- The Teacher Powerpoint provides all the audio files and links to quizzes/Quizlet/videos in one place.

- The resources for student goal setting, reflection and exit slips/pulse checks give the students a starting point with the language they need to articulate their reflections. 

- The glossary of grammatical terms is handy for students to stick in their books for reference.

- The range of activities and products are meaningful and engaging to students at this level.  

- There is scope within this unit to revisit or consolidate concepts from Year 7.
